A MEMS device includes a fixed supporting body forming a cavity, a mobile element suspended over the cavity, and an elastic element arranged between the fixed supporting body and the mobile element. First, second, third, and fourth piezoelectric elements are mechanically coupled to the elastic element, which has a shape symmetrical with respect to a direction. The first and second piezoelectric elements are arranged symmetrically with respect to the third and fourth piezoelectric elements, respectively. The first and fourth piezoelectric elements are configured to receive a first control signal, whereas the second and third piezoelectric elements are configured to receive a second control signal, which is in phase opposition with respect to the first control signal so that the first, second, third, and fourth piezoelectric elements deform the elastic element, with consequent rotation of the mobile element about the direction.

Embodiments of the present application disclose a light field display control method and apparatus and a light field display device. The light field display control method comprises: determining a partial depth distribution sub-region of content according to at least depth distribution information of the content; and tilting a first display unit at least with respect to an original plane of a display array of a light field display device according to a display depth of field (DoF) range of the light field display device and the depth distribution sub-region, wherein the first display unit is a display unit that is in the display array and affects display of a first object, and the first object is a part, which is located in the depth distribution sub-region, of the content. The present application can improve display quality of an object, which is located in a partial depth distribution sub-region, of content to be displayed or content being displayed.

The present disclosure relates to a holographic display system including: a projection object having a three-dimensional shape corresponding to an original item; an image projection unit comprising projectors projecting unit images of parts selected from a three-dimensional image of the original item on the projection object; and a reflector disposed adjacent to the projection object and reflecting images reflected from the projection object to provide an augmented three-dimensional holographic image. In the disclosure, the unit images corresponding to a three-dimensional image of an original item are projected on the projection object having a three-dimensional shape corresponding to the original item using the projectors and reflected by the projection object and augmented by the reflector, thereby providing a virtual image having three dimensional information corresponding to the original item, whereby a proper image is provided to an observer even when the viewpoint of the observer is changed.
